Book Synopsis The Web Empowerment Book by : Ralph Abraham

Download or read book The Web Empowerment Book written by Ralph Abraham and published by Springer Science & Business Media. This book was released on 1995-04-13 with total page 228 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This "how to" book explains, in simple, pragmatic terms, how to go about navigating through and understanding the way the Web works. It also provides an extensive package of "freeware" software via the Internet which allows users to access browsers and display software to make full use of the Web.
